The Quality Assurance and Training Manager, Medical Group, is a dynamic leader responsible for overseeing all quality monitoring and staff development activities within the Shriners Medical Group. This role plays a pivotal part in shaping Shriners Children’s Medical Group’s emerging national infrastructure. The Quality Assurance and Training Manager will be instrumental in building a unified culture of accountability, operational excellence, and data literacy across multiple regions. This position ensures that every patient, regardless of location, experiences consistent, high-quality, and efficient service aligned with the organization’s mission and performance standards.
This is a full-time, full benefits eligible position with a pay range of $104,500 to $156,750 determined by years of relevant experience and departmental equity.
